MD is trying to piggyback on VA’s “success”. Looks like they’re “learning” and incentivizing early registration, with the hope that those don’t register early will see $1000/firearm as too expensive and sell them out of state. It also aims to reduce the number of firearms people own in MD. The guy with 3 AR’s might only register one and sell the others. Those with a dozen or more will simply move out of state. Hogan the RINO will sign it too.
http://mgaleg.maryland.gov/2020RS/bills/hb/hb1261F.pdf?fbclid=IwAR3vM6qNQfjFiHkhFEQEBKLemzqchKM5VlyMNgQeoN-Dk9FJYKa41eX8USM SUBTITLE. (III) A PERSON WHO VOLUNTARILY REGISTERS AN ASSAULT LONG GUN OR A COPYCAT WEAPON AS DESCRIBED IN SUBPARAGRAPH (II) OF THIS PARAGRAPH IS SUBJECT TO: 1. ON OR AFTER JANUARY 1, 2021, AND BEFORE MAY 1, 2021, A REGISTRATION FEE NOT EXCEEDING $290 PER FIREARM; 2. ON OR AFTER MAY 1, 2021, AND BEFORE NOVEMBER 1, 2022, A REGISTRATION FEE NOT EXCEEDING $580 PER FIREARM; AND 3. ON OR AFTER NOVEMBER 1, 2022, AND BEFORE MAY 1, 2023, A REGISTRATION FEE NOT EXCEEDING $1,000 PER FIREARM. (IV) 1. A PERSON WHO LAWFULLY POSSESSED AN ASSAULT LONG GUN OR A COPYCAT WEAPON BEFORE OCTOBER 1, 2020, AND WHO REGISTERS HOUSE BILL 1261 7 8 HOUSE BILL 1261 1 THE ASSAULT LONG GUN OR COPYCAT WEAPON ON OR AFTER JANUARY 1, 2021, AND 2 BEFORE MAY 1, 2023, ONLY AFTER BEING DISCOVERED IN POSSESSION OF THE 3 ASSAULT LONG GUN OR COPYCAT WEAPON BY A LAW ENFORCEMENT OFFICER, IS 4 NOT SUBJECT TO THE PENALTIES IN § 4–306 OF THIS SUBTITLE. |
